They are two things missing:

each spectrasonics xpander comes with a common bonus section. so if you bought one, you got those bonus section which is made up of loops from vocal planet, distorted reality, bizarre guitar and some xtras.

 

ilio I hear will be similarly offering a bonus ilio section in their xpanders.

 

 

also they are multis that come with the xpanders, although spectrasonics allows registered users to download these multis from their website, and ilio may too.

To b3kys:

The difference between the original Akai/ Roland CD-ROMs and the self packed expanders is none. When converted by the "SAGE Converter" program. Same material/ same possibilities. Exept the expanders has some bonus material. This bonus material (found in the spectrasonic titels) has nothing to do with the titel of the libraries and is the same for all four spectrasonic titels. This material is taken from "Vocal planet", "Distored Reality 1&2" and "Bizare guitar".

Hope this clearifies things a bit.
